Replacement Schedule

Plan to replace air filters every 15,000-30,000 miles, or more frequently in dusty conditions under normal driving conditions. Track your mileage for timely replacement.

Technical Information

Engine air filters prevent dirt, dust, and debris from entering your engine, protecting internal components.

Available Types

  • Paper/cellulose
  • Cotton gauze (washable)
  • Foam
  • Oil-wetted

Key Benefits

  • Improved fuel efficiency
  • Better acceleration
  • Engine protection
  • Lower emissions

Warning Signs to Watch For

  • Reduced fuel economy
  • Sluggish acceleration
  • Engine misfires
  • Dirty filter visible on inspection

Recommended Replacement Interval

15,000-30,000 miles, or more frequently in dusty conditions

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I find the right air filters for my Volkswagen Passat?

Verify compatibility using your Volkswagen Passat's VIN number, production year (2020-2022), and engine code. Check seller compatibility charts and cross-reference OEM part numbers when possible.

Should I use OEM or aftermarket air filters for my Volkswagen Passat?

OEM parts guarantee exact Volkswagen specifications and fitment. Quality aftermarket brands often meet or exceed OEM standards at lower prices. For warranty vehicles, check if aftermarket parts affect coverage.

How often should I replace air filters on my Volkswagen Passat?

General guideline: 15,000-30,000 miles, or more frequently in dusty conditions. However, driving conditions (city vs highway, climate, towing) affect replacement frequency. Inspect regularly and replace when warning signs appear.
